What Do I Need To Join?
We require that all members:
- Have a home base assembly within the Great Awakening International Assemblies, where you are receiving continual Torah teachings under the leadership of a leading Moreh
- Be committed to set rehearsals and feast days and other community events
- Be in good standing at your local assembly
- Be committed and dependable
If you believe you pass the criteria above, you must do the following:
- Fill out the International Hebrew Choir Interest form below
- Submit a video to the link that will be provided
- If you are chosen, you will receive an email confirmation
*Note- Excessive absences and/or lack of participation in scheduled meetings/rehearsals will not be acceptable and may lead to your dismissal of the choir
